Emerging Importance of Probiotics

Probiotics—an introduction

Ingestion of probiotics dates back thousands of years, and not just in adults. Many countries worldwide have a tradition of introducing live active cultures (bacteria) to infants and children early in life, in fermented foods such as yogurt.

Probiotics (meaning "for life") are live, nonpathogenic microorganisms that, when consumed in adequate amounts, provide specific health benefits to the host.1 Clinical benefits include aiding digestion, treating and preventing viral diarrhea, reducing the risk of necrotizing enterocolitis (NEC) and supporting a healthy immune system.2-4 Approximately 70%-80% of the body's immune cells are located within the gastrointestinal tract, specifically within the gut-associated lymphoid tissue (GALT).5

The dietary use of probiotics is strain-specific; various probiotics promote different health benefits.6 Lactobacillus is one of the most widely studied genera of probiotics, proving numerous health benefits across many illnesses.6 BOOST Kid Essentials Nutritionally Complete Drink contains Lactobacillus reuteri Protectis, delivered through the straw, to help support a healthy immune system.

Probiotics contribute to a healthy immune system by:2-4

  • Balancing the intestinal flora; probiotics increase the number of beneficial bacteria and occupy receptors to displace harmful bacteria
  • Acidifying the intestinal lumen to create an environment unfavorable to less desirable bacteria
  • Improving gut barrier function through the production of short-chain fatty acids, especially butyric acid
  • Helping to build and maintain a healthy immune system modulating the immune response and increasing production of immunoglobulins (such as secretory-IgA)
  • Enhancing the production of a balanced T-helper-cell response (by influencing the differentiation of T-helper cells into Th1 or Th2 cells)
Why is a balanced microflora important?

A healthy intestinal flora performs many important functions in the body, including:

  • Digestion of complex foods, such as fiber
  • Enhancing the absorption of nutrients from food
  • Synthesis of vitamins
  • Supporting the intestinal barrier function

Are probiotics effective against viruses?

Yes. Certain probiotics have been shown to help fight viral infection/illness such as Rotaviral diarrhea.1 Lactobacillus reuteri Protectis (the probiotic found in BOOST® Kid Essentials) has been shown to reduce the duration of diarrheal illness in children3 and reduce the number of days that infants miss daycare due to illness.2

Is BOOST® Kid Essentials Drink an energy drink?

No. Energy drinks typically contain some type of stimulant, such as caffeine or ginseng, along with high levels of sugar. BOOST Kid Essentials Drink provides the complete nutrition that children need without stimulants or large amounts of sugar.

Does BOOST® Kid Essentials Drink contain the recommended daily levels of key nutrients like iron and calcium?

BOOST Kid Essentials Drink meets 100% of the Dietary Reference Intakes for 25 essential vitamins and minerals in 34 fluid ounces for children ages 1 to 8 years, and in 51 fluid ounces for children 9 to 13 years. This includes requirements for iron and calcium. Each 8.25 fluid ounce serving provides 3.4 mg of iron and 290 mg of calcium.
